CLARKSVILLE, TN (CLARKSVILLE NOW) – After a couple of weeks of wet days, we’re now looking a clear skies for as far at the eye can see.
Starting Monday, skies will be sunny and clear every day through Friday, according to the National Weather Service.
Highs will start around 80 and steadily rise to 90 by week’s end. Lows will start in the mid-50s and rise to the low 60s.
